BD 0.3ml Insulin Syringe & Needle

BD 0.3 mL syringes are for insulin doses under 30 units of insulin and are numbered at 1-unit intervals.

Prescription supply

Prescription-only medicines (POM) are always dispensed against a valid, patient-specific prescription and are never available as clinic stock, under any circumstances.

Where a product genuinely supports both routes, you choose whether you are ordering that item on prescription for a named patient or as clinic stock under your professional responsibility when you select it on the product page.

Named-patient prescription supply. Items chosen for a named patient are dispensed against your prescription. The order is held for Superintendent Pharmacist review before despatch. Prescription supply is zero-rated for VAT.

Clinic stock supply. Where eligible, items chosen as clinic stock are supplied under your professional responsibility for use in your practice. Standard VAT applies at checkout. This route is never offered for prescription-only medicines.

Orders containing prescription-only medicines are held until the Superintendent Pharmacist has cleared the prescription. Same-day dispatch applies once cleared.
